so we custom ordered our bedding from Baby Grand in St. Paul. Anyhow, we ordered in April, and they said 5-6 weeks. After calling over the past month, it finally got here and i picked it up on Saturday. Anyhow, there are some concerns I have which seem minimal, but I am upset as I feel like if you are ordering your bedding/having it made through a store, then there shouldn't be crappy workmanship - - such as 

1) Pattern on valance is cut crooked, corners on valance are different (one squared off and one angled

2) seams on bumper and on valance do not match up - - instead of using one bolt of fabric, when she had to cut/match the seams they don't exactly match up so the pattern is off. 1 of the sections of bumper isn't as filled as the others

3) the blanket isn't even the size of the crib. I guess I expected when I ordered a crib blanket that it would be as big as the crib mattress, but it is considerably smaller. I guess this in itself isn't a deal breaker, but the mismatched seams, crooked cutting etc does upset me.

Am I being too picky? We paid nearly $400 for this so I feel like at least the seams should match up and it shouldn't be cut completely crooked. But maybe I am just 37.5 weeks preggo and emotional?
